Well this is an old discussion but a year down the track and all of it on the Kipuna I have to say I'm having soo much fun!!

I jumped on my TT Cab custom 133 for the first time yesterday in about 12 months - and it wasn't nice!! ( but it is a great board!!)

The U'D kipuna is a great fun board on both flat water and out off the beach - cant fault it really (but be aware I'm not a surfer before kitesurfing) . I'm into boosting often and (touch wood) is showing no signs of it abuse!

I see underground have a new look board of the same tech and of course Axis have a similar board (not sure what the difference between the two might be?)

Best thing for me is the 'ease on the kneeze' with this board - comfortable for hours on the water. Just thought I'd share my experience!

If I manage to break this one I will be looking for a replacement ASAP!!
